Stadium of Fire
'It's Stadium of Fire's 40th anniversary and we're not holding back. This will be a big show,' Executive Director of America's Freedom Festival at Provo Jim Evans said in a press release.
The event is headlined by Grammy-winning country singer Lee Greenwood and four-time Billboard, number-one hits country singer Collin Raye.
'Typically we only have one headliner, but this year we have two major performers. Lee Greenwood is a Grammy-award winning artist and famous for his song 'Proud to be an American,' and Raye is another legendary country music artist, who's been in the industry forever,' Blue Helm Communications team member Emory Cook said.
On top of the two country icons, stunt group Nitro Circus will be performing death-defying motorcycle stunts.

Putting the event together didn't come easy as Stadium of Fire organizers had to maneuver the ever-changing COVID-19 guidelines early in the year, according to Cook.
'We've been planning all year, it's been a very different year just because there's more uncertainty leading up to the event because of Covid-19,' Cook said.
Even now, Stadium of Fire organizers are dealing with the lingering effects of COVID-19 as the question of full capacity is still in the air. Stadium of Fire currently has a capacity of over 20,000 and is unsure if it will be allowed a full-capacity for the event, Cook said.
Stadium of Fire will also honor Utah's first responders during the COVID-19 pandemic.
